Meridian Bank House of the Week: $2.2M Historic Dual-Residence Estate in Washington Crossing

A historic home, known as the Matthias Harvey Estate, offering two residences on 3 acres, is available for sale in Washington Crossing

The main residence, the Canal House, dates back to 1709 and has been carefully updated to balance modern comfort with preserved period character. 

Inside, the home features three bedrooms and three-and-a-half bathrooms, with original pumpkin pine floors, pie staircases, deep-set windows, antique hardware, and two fireplaces throughout. 

Modern upgrades include heated floors, walk-in cedar closets, and updated lighting, all thoughtfully integrated without compromising the home’s historic charm. 

The second residence is a beautifully restored circa-1840 barn home, relocated from Kutztown

This home offers three ensuite bedrooms, plus a full pool bathroom, and showcases soaring ceilings, wide-plank floors, large windows, and two dramatic turned staircases.

The gourmet kitchen is equipped with premium stainless-steel appliances, soapstone countertops, and cabinetry crafted from reclaimed barn wood, while Moravian tile accents add unique architectural detail. 

Outdoor amenities include a rectangular in-ground pool surrounded by gardens and patios, a covered three-season entertainment area built from original barn stone with a large fireplace and fire pit, and a tranquil pond.  

Additional features include a converted springhouse with a gym and wine cellar, a detached three-car garage, backup generators for both homes, and direct access to the canal towpath. 

The property is located in the Council Rock School District
